Potassium induces relaxation and hyperpolarization of circular muscles but contraction of longitudinal muscles of pig duodenum.

Abstract

The mechanisms by which K+ relaxes circular muscles of pig duodenum were investigated, and compared with the response of the longitudinal muscles to K+. Circular muscles were concentration-dependently relaxed by 8.3-23.6 mM K+, but contracted by 47.2-143.4 mM K+. Longitudinal muscles were contracted by 11.8-94.4 mM K+. The relaxation of circular muscles was correlated with hyperpolarization (4 mV), but evoked Ca2+ spikes were not suppressed. Neither ouabain (0.14 microM) nor phentolamine (10 microM) blocked the relaxation, but tetrodotoxin (TTX, 0.63 microM) blocked both the relaxation and hyperpolarization. Mesaconitine (0.16 microM) increased the relaxation. Inhibitory junction potentials and concomitant relaxations were also blocked by TTX. The results suggest that K+-induced relaxation is caused by the release of a non-adrenergic inhibitory transmitter.

摘要

研究了钾离子使猪十二指肠环行肌松弛的机制,并与纵向肌对钾离子的反应进行了比较。8.3 - 23.6 mM的钾离子可使环行肌呈浓度依赖性松弛,但47.2 - 143.4 mM的钾离子则使其收缩。11.8 - 94.4 mM的钾离子可使纵向肌收缩。环行肌的松弛与超极化(4 mV)相关,但诱发的钙离子尖峰未被抑制。哇巴因(0.14 microM)和酚妥拉明(10 microM)均未阻断松弛作用,但河豚毒素(TTX,0.63 microM)可同时阻断松弛和超极化。中乌头碱(0.16 microM)增强了松弛作用。抑制性接头电位及伴随的松弛也被TTX阻断。结果表明,钾离子诱导的松弛是由一种非肾上腺素能抑制性递质的释放所引起的。
